ON-LINE ESTIMATION METHOD OF BATTERY STATE OF HEALTH IN WIDE TEMPERATURE RANGE BASED ON
Abstract:
An on-line State of Health estimation method of a battery in a wide temperature range based on “standardized temperature” includes: calculating battery Incremental Capacity curve of a battery, establishing a quantitative relationship between the voltage shift of the temperature-sensitive feature point and the temperature of a standard battery, standardized transformation of Incremental Capacity curves at different temperatures, establishing a quantitative relationship between the transformed height of the capacity-sensitive feature point and the State of Health based on a BOX-COX transformation. The BOX-COX transformation is expressed as y k ( λ ) = { y k λ - 1 λ λ ≠ 0 ln ⁢ ⁢ y k λ = 0 . An maximum likelihood function is used to calculate the optimal λ, and the transformed height of the capacity-sensitive feature point y can be acquired. The quantitative relationship between transformed height of the capacity-sensitive feature point and the State of Health is established to obtain the State of Health.
